Your Maverick already has grease fittings except for the original upper controll arm bushings--which should have been replaced a long time ago. The replacements have grease zerks and if you grease 'em once a year, your suspension will be as quiet as a new car...

: I have two 74 Mavericks, both 4 door, one a 250 and one a 302. I have heard that I need to install grease fittings to get rid of the horrible squeaks in my Mavericks' front ends. There are two other Mavericks in the neighborhood that have the same problem, so I'm sure someone out there has already done a fix for it. Has anyone done this to their vehicle already who would have any hints or tips?
